CVE-2022-50355

staging: vt6655: fix some erroneous memory clean-up loops

In the Linux kernel, the following vulnerability has been resolved:

staging: vt6655: fix some erroneous memory clean-up loops

In some initialization functions of this driver, memory is allocated with
'i' acting as an index variable and increasing from 0. The commit in
"Fixes" introduces some clean-up codes in case of allocation failure,
which free memory in reverse order with 'i' decreasing to 0. However,
there are some problems:
  - The case i=0 is left out. Thus memory is leaked.
  - In case memory allocation fails right from the start, the memory
    freeing loops will start with i=-1 and invalid memory locations will
    be accessed.

One of these loops has been fixed in commit c8ff91535880 ("staging:
vt6655: fix potential memory leak"). Fix the remaining erroneous loops.

LinuxLinux Kernel Version >= 4.18 < 4.19.262
LinuxLinux Kernel Version >= 4.20 < 5.4.220
LinuxLinux Kernel Version >= 5.5 < 5.10.150
LinuxLinux Kernel Version >= 5.11 < 5.15.75
LinuxLinux Kernel Version >= 5.16 < 5.19.17
LinuxLinux Kernel Version >= 6.0 < 6.0.3

CWE-401 Missing Release of Memory after Effective Lifetime

The product does not sufficiently track and release allocated memory after it has been used, which slowly consumes remaining memory.
